Job Description
The Manufacturing Engineering Technician supports production by studying manufacturing processes, conducting time studies, and helping establish accurate labor standards. This role works closely with Manufacturing Engineering, Planning, Production, and Finance.
Create basic process maps and break jobs into standard work elements
Plan and prepare time studies (method, sample size, data collection)
Coordinate with Planning and Production to schedule time studies during live runs
Perform time studies on the shop floor using approved methods
Identify factors that affect cycle time (changeovers, delays, rework, staffing, etc.)
Verify data accuracy and flag abnormal conditions
Provide time study results to Finance for labor costing and analysis
Maintain clear documentation for review and audit purposes
